First let:
z -be the total number of plants in her front yard
y -be the number of plants in x weeks
x - be the number of weeks

We can form an equation
{{{y=4+2x}}} given she currently have 4 plants

AFTER X WEEKS
60% of total number of plants (y) will be in her backyard
0.6y

40% of total number of plants (y) will be in her frontyard
0.4y or z

{{{z=0.4y}}} substitute {{{y=4+2x}}}
{{{z=0.4(4+2x)}}}
{{{z=1.6+0.8x}}}

where:
z -be the total number of plants in her front yard
x - be the number of weeks
